Berry Cheesecake Bars | Keto/Paleo

May 31, 2020 by Valerie

Jump to recipe

A while back on my IG stories, I asked what you might want to see more of. The poll pointed in the direction of more Paleo Desserts! I was very pleased to see that because right now, I’m all about the treats. And as luck would have it, I was craving cheesecake but with a berry flavor. I’m usually a chocolate treat lover …but Berry Cheesecake Bars sounded so good, so here they are!

I thought about making them into individual cheesecakes using parchment muffin liners but I didn’t have any on hand ….and I was already in full swing with making this dessert. I would venture to say, these would be perfect to make in muffin liners! I will be doing that next time, for sure.

These Berry Cheesecake Bars are not only keto but can be made paleo too! Just switch out the butter for ghee and you’re good to go. Likewise with the cream cheese – use Kite Hill to keep it dairy free or use regular cream cheese if that’s your preference.

Berry Cheesecake Bars | Keto/Paleo

Print this recipe
Valerie
May 31, 2020
by Valerie
Category Desserts Keto Snacks
Persons
9
Serving Size
1 bar
Prep Time
15 minutes
Cook Time
15 minutes
Total Time
30 minutes

Notes

*I put my jam into a bowl and used the handheld mixer to smooth it out a bit for easier spreading

Ingredients

  • Crust:
  • 1 cup almond flour
  • 8 tbsp butter or ghee, melted
  • 2 tbsp monk fruit
  • Cheesecake:
  • 8 oz Kite Hill Cream “Cheese” or regular cream cheese
  • 1 egg yolk
  • 2 1/2 tbsp monkfruit
  • 1/2 tbsp pure vanilla extract
  • Topping:
  • 10 oz S/F Red Raspberry Jam (I use one jar of St. Dalfour’s)
  • Crumble:
  • 1/4 cup chopped pecans (or favorite nut)
  • 1 tbsp monk fruit
  • 2 tbsp butter, softened (or ghee)
  • 2 tbsp almond flour

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  2. In a small bowl, melt butter …then add almond flour and monk fruit. Mix and pour into an 8×8 baking sheet, lined with parchment paper.
  3. Bake at 350° for 10 minutes.
  4. While it’s in the oven, prepare the cheesecake by whipping up cream “cheese”, monk fruit, egg yolk and vanilla extract w/a handheld mixer.
  5. Once crust is out of the oven, let it cool for 10 minutes. Use this time to make the crumble.
  6. In a small bowl, mix the softened butter, pecan pieces, monk fruit and almond butter with a fork.
  7. Spread the cheesecake on top of crust, layer the jam*(see note) on top of cheesecake carefully and dollop the crumble on top of jam.
  8. Bake at 350° for about 15-18 minutes.
  9. Let cool completely (refrigerating is best) before slicing into it.
  10. Cut into 9 bars. Enjoy!

Do you have a coupe of ripe bananas to use up?? Go Do you have a coupe of ripe bananas to use up?? Good! Here’s a delish & easy recipe for you! 

Paleo BANANA COFFEE CAKE Bars! 🍌 

Let me know what you think! 

✨Banana Coffee Cake Bars✨

1 cup almond flour 
1/3 cup tapioca flour
1/3 cup coconut sugar 
2 tsp cinnamon 
1 tsp baking powder
Pinch of salt 
2 large ripe bananas 
4 eggs
1 tsp pure vanilla extract 

Topping: 

1/3 cup chopped pecans 
2 tbsp coconut sugar 
3 tsp cinnamon 
2 tbsp softened butter or coconut oil (not melted)

Preheat oven to 350°

Smash banana and put into a medium bowl, along with the eggs, and vanilla. Combine. 

In another bowl, mix flours, coconut sugar, cinnamon, baking soda and salt. Whisk together. Then add to the banana bowl and mix til incorporated. 

Make the topping in a small bowl, using a fork to smash all ingredients together. 

Line an 8x8 baking pan with parchment paper. Pour the banana batter into the lined baking pan 

Top with topping, randomly placing small chunks on top of batter …trying to evenly distribute. 

Bake at 350° for 30 min. Cool on cooling rack for at least 15 min (can be cut warm, carefully). Use a bread knife to cut into 16 squares. 

Enjoy with a hot cup of coffee!
